Location: | Montreal |
---|---|
Type: | Full-time |
Remote status: | Hybrid |
Posted on: | Apr 24, 2023 |
National Bank is carrying out the biggest technology upgrade in its history. We’re reviewing our systems and processes to simplify them and align them more closely with our clients’ needs.
Do you love technology? Do you enjoy working on hands-on projects? Are you naturally inquisitive? Do you like challenging the status quo?
If you have boundless energy, like to take initiative and enjoy working as part of a team, read on!
As a Site Reliability Engineer/DevOps, you are a specialist in developing and managing resilient critical assets. You will actively participate in implementing our DevOps vision by integrating SRE best practices. Concretely, you will work with the asset manager to develop one of the Bank’s most critical inventories of applications using certain tools.
Your role:
·Create applications and services in “Infra as code” mode that meet business objectives while ensuring they develop sustainably.
·Ensure the stability and resilience of our platforms
·Document and promote our monitoring toolkits
·Collaborate with the PO and the tech lead for planning technical activities
·Adapt our monitoring assets
·Offer the DevOps teams technical support with their objective to meet the SLOs defined by our business lines
·Suggest improvements to methods and alternatives to obsolete technologies in the SRE field.
We want to contribute to your quality of life by offering you as much flexibility as possible in your work. For example, we offer a hybrid (remote and in the office) work model, work schedule arrangements to help you achieve work/life balance, and flexible leave that you can take when it's important to you.
- Completed bachelor’s degree OR other degree in a related field with several years of relevant experience
- 4 years of prior experience in Java development or system administrator.
- Continuous deployments, automated tests, application monitoring, Docker, Kubernetes, AWS
- Collaboration (JIRA/Confluence)
- Source code management (SCM: Git)
- Continuous integration servers (Jenkins 2 with pipeline as code, CircleCI)
- Continuous builds (Maven, Groovy, Ant)
- Continuous testing (Sauce Labs, Selenium)
- Continuous code inspection for technical debt/security awareness (Veracode)
- Artifact management (Nexus)
- Reports and dashboards (SonarQube)
- Sourcing and orchestration tools (Docker/k8s)
- Ansible/Python, Terraform
- Application monitoring (Splunk, Datadog or equivalent) to measure all these applications and ensure they deliver the expected business value to our clients
- You’re a hands-on person with an agile mindset.
- Bilingualism required: Ability to communicate effectively in English (to work with English-speaking suppliers)
Your benefits:
In addition to competitive compensation, upon hiring you’ll be eligible for a wide range of flexible benefits to help promote your wellbeing and that of your family.
- Health and wellness program, including many options
- Flexible group insurance
- Generous pension plan
- Employee Share Ownership Plan
- Employee and Family Assistance Program
- Preferential banking services
- Initiatives promoting community involvement
- Telemedicine service
- Virtual sleep clinic
These are a few of the benefits available to you. We have an offer that keeps up with trends as well as your needs and those of your family.
Our dynamic work environments and cutting-edge collaboration tools foster a positive employee experience. We actively listen to employees’ ideas. Whether through our surveys or programs, regular feedback and ongoing communication is encouraged.
We're putting people first :
We're a bank on a human scale that stands out for its courage, entrepreneurial culture, and passion for people. Our mission is to have a positive impact on peoples' lives.
Our core values of partnership, agility, and empowerment inspire us, and inclusivity is central to our commitments. We offer a barrier-free workplace that is accessible to all employees.
We want our recruitment process to be fully accessible. If you require accommodations, feel free to let us know during your first conversations with us.
We welcome all candidates! What can you bring to our team?
Ready to live your ambitions?
How to apply to this developer job?
Latest developer jobs in Montreal
- Team Lead (UI Programming) – [Assassin’s Creed: Codename INVICTUS]UbisoftJob description As the Lead UI Programming Team Leader, you will guide a talented and inspired programming team in developing essential technologies for the highly anticipated games by Ubisoft fans. …📍 Montreal⏱ Full-time🚗🗓 Mar 22, 2024
- Programmer (Engine)UbisoftJob description Ubisoft Montreal strives to offer gamers an impressive visual experience, as well as incomparable level of immersion. The fluidity and vitality of our worlds make this experience even…📍 Montreal⏱ Full-time🚗🗓 Mar 22, 2024
- Programmer (Gameplay)UbisoftJob description When you’re a Gameplay Programmer at Ubi Montreal, you have direct influence over the quality of the game that will end up in the players’ hands; there is a tangible link between your…📍 Montreal⏱ Full-time🚗🗓 Mar 22, 2024
- Project Lead (Programming) – Assassin’s Creed codename INVICTUSUbisoftJob description Work as a programming project lead for Assassin’s Creed Codename INVICTUS which is a new multiplayer game in the Assassin’s Creed Family currently in development at Ubisoft Montréal! …📍 Montreal⏱ Full-time🚗🗓 Mar 22, 2024
- Senior Software Development ManagerAutodeskJob Requisition ID # 24WD76574 La traduction en Français se trouve plus bas!/The French translation can be found below! About Autodesk Autodesk's Entertainment and Media Solutions (EMS) group is …📍 Montreal, Toronto⏱ Full-time🚗 Hybrid🗓 Mar 13, 2024